Abstract

Embodiments are directed to determining, by a processing device, a state of an internal power supply associated with a lock, and selecting, by the processing device, at least one of the internal power supply and an external power supply to power the lock based on the determination of the state of the internal power supply.

Claims (41)

1 . A method comprising:

determining, by a processing device, a state of an internal power supply associated with a lock; and

selecting, by the processing device, at least one of the internal power supply and an external power supply to power the lock based on the determination of the state of the internal power supply.

2 . The method of claim 1 , further comprising:

harvesting energy from a device associated with the external power supply.

3 . The method of claim 2 , wherein the device associated with external power supply comprises a mobile phone, the method further comprising:

receiving a command from the mobile phone to change a state of the lock.

4 . The method of claim 3 , wherein the command comprises at least one credential, the method further comprising:

changing the state of the lock based on an authentication of the at least one credential.

5 . The method of claim 3 , wherein the energy is wirelessly harvested from the mobile phone and the command is received from the mobile phone using a near field communication (NFC).

6 . The method of claim 3 , further comprising:

generating an entry in a data log based on the command.

7 . The method of claim 6 , wherein the entry specifies one or more of: (i) the date and time that the command was received, (ii) whether the state of the lock was changed in response to the command, (iii) the state that the lock was changed from when the state of the lock is changed, (iv) the state that the lock was changed to when the state of the lock is changed, (v) an identity of the mobile phone, and (vi) an identity of a user associated with the mobile phone.

8 . The method of claim 1 , wherein the lock comprises at least one of an electromechanical replaceable lock core and a standard electronic lock.

9 . The method of claim 1 , further comprising:

selecting, by the processing device, the internal power supply to power the lock when the determination of the state of the internal power supply indicates that the internal power supply provides power in an amount greater than a threshold and otherwise selecting the external power supply to power the lock.

10 . A lock core comprising:

an energy storage element;

a harvester configured to harvest energy from a source located external from the lock core;

an actuator configured to control a state of a lock associated with the lock core;

a storage device configured to selectively receive energy from the energy storage element and the harvester and provide energy to the actuator; and

a processing device configured to select whether the storage device receives energy from the energy storage element or the harvester to provide the energy to the actuator.

11 . The lock core of claim 10 , wherein the processing device comprises at least one of a PIC, an MSP-class device, a digital signal processor, and a microcontroller unit (MCU).

12 . The lock core of claim 10 , wherein the source located external from the lock core comprises a mobile phone.

13 . The lock core of claim 12 , further comprising:

a transceiver configured to receive a command from the mobile phone to change a state of the lock.

14 . The lock core of claim 13 , wherein the command comprises at least one credential, and wherein the lock core is configured to change a state of the lock based on an authentication of the at least one credential.

15 . The lock core of claim 10 , further comprising:

a first switch configured to selectively provide energy from the energy storage element to the storage device; and

a second switch configured to selectively provide energy from the harvester to the storage device.

16 . The lock core of claim 15 , further comprising:

a third switch configured to selectively provide energy from the harvester to the processing device.

17 . The lock core of claim 10 , wherein the storage device comprises a super-capacitor.

18 . The lock core of claim 10 , wherein a sleep current associated with the lock core is within an order of magnitude of one microampere.

19 . The lock core of claim 10 , wherein the energy storage element comprises a battery.

20 . The lock core of claim 19 , wherein the processing device is configured to select the harvester to provide the energy to the actuator when the battery provides energy in an amount less than a threshold, and wherein the energy provided to the actuator by the harvester is used to remove the core so that the battery can be replaced.

21 . The lock core of claim 19 , wherein access to the lock core is a function of an amount of energy provided by the battery and a level associated with a user attempting to access the lock core.

22 . A lock core comprising:

a power circuit configured to be powered directly from a mobile key,

wherein the power circuit does not include an internal primary battery storage.

23 . The lock core of claim 22 , wherein the mobile key comprises a phone.
